To solve a problem of a conventional changing-over lever wherein the change-over lever rotates with a fulcrum as a center by finger pressing, and therefore, as the changing-over lever is rotationally moved, contact areas of the finger with a lever (arm) section of the changing-over lever is gradually decreased, thereby making the fingers to gradually become slippery on the changing-over lever, preventing reliable finger pressing.
The changing-over mechanism is provided with a finger-touching plate upper cover 58, a finger-touching plate main body 67, a lever shaft 66 built-in the finger-touching plate main body 67, a lever arm 53 having a small recessed section 51 turnably engaged with the supporting shaft 59 at one end portion thereof and a large recessed section 52 engaged with a protruding section of a rack 22 at the other end thereof, a link arm 54, and a pin shaft 57 engagedly fixing the link arm 54 to a link arm receiving section 68 of the finger-touching plate main body 67. The finger touching plate main body 67 is translated (parallel slides) downward while being substantially parallel maintained.
